Transaction 16d5724cfd583824aee04b336bba1f64021d40cd0557032ae56cf1e6b5f31dbf
1 Input
2 Outputs
- 16d5724cfd583824aee04b336bba1f64021d40cd0557032ae56cf1e6b5f31dbf:0
- 16d5724cfd583824aee04b336bba1f64021d40cd0557032ae56cf1e6b5f31dbf:1
value 2994158
address 18ozVhK9ywvqMaSL851PiaDJkpX33EwQFX
value 27451269
address 1dB1T6XbNwgkGDDiWg7UkGr814kP3fnav